public function ConfirmItemDeleteForm::submitForm in Queue UI 8.2
Parameters
array $form:
\Drupal\Core\Form\FormStateInterface $form_state:
Overrides FormInterface::submitForm
File
- src/
Form/ ConfirmItemDeleteForm.php, line 100
Class
- ConfirmItemDeleteForm
- Class ConfirmItemDeleteForm @package Drupal\queue_ui\Form
Namespace
Drupal\queue_ui\FormCode
public function submitForm(array &$form, FormStateInterface $form_state) {
$queue_ui = $this->queueUIManager
->fromQueueName($this->queue_name);
$queue_ui
->deleteItem($this->queue_item);
$this->messenger
->addMessage("Deleted queue item " . $this->queue_item);
$form_state
->setRedirectUrl(Url::fromRoute('queue_ui.inspect', [
'queue_name' => $this->queue_name,
]));
}